What problem does it solve?

This skill helps users understand complex data by transforming raw data into clear and informative visual representations like charts and plots.

Core Features & Use Cases

  • Intelligent Visualization Selection: Analyzes data structure to automatically choose the best chart type (bar, line, scatter).
  • Automated Generation: Creates visualizations using best practices for clarity and accuracy.
  • Use Case: Transform a CSV file of monthly sales figures into a line graph to easily identify trends and patterns.
